The Potential Impact and Challenges of Quantum Encryption Technology on Proxy IP Security

Quantum encryption technology has made significant strides in recent years, promising to revolutionize data protection and security systems. As proxy ip services are increasingly used for privacy protection and data masking, understanding the potential impact of quantum encryption on their security is crucial. Quantum encryption leverages the principles of quantum mechanics to enhance cryptography, making traditional encryption methods more vulnerable to breaches. This article delves into how quantum encryption might influence the security of proxy ips, examining both the positive potential and the challenges it poses for future privacy strategies. Introduction to Quantum Encryption and Proxy IP SecurityIn the world of digital security, proxy IPs serve as an essential tool to mask a user's real IP address and provide privacy online. However, the increasing sophistication of cyberattacks and the rise of quantum computing pose new challenges. Quantum encryption technology, which uses quantum keys and quantum entanglement to encrypt data, holds the potential to transform security measures across industries, including proxy IP services.Quantum encryption works on the premise that observing a quantum system disturbs its state, thereby preventing eavesdropping. This could theoretically make communication systems much more secure. However, the rapid development of quantum computing brings a new set of risks to traditional cryptographic techniques, including the encryption methods used by proxy IP services.Impact of Quantum Encryption on Proxy IP SecurityQuantum encryption presents both promising opportunities and substantial risks for the security of proxy IPs.1. Increased Resistance to Conventional Attacks: The implementation of quantum encryption could enhance the security of proxy IP services against conventional hacking attempts. Classical encryption algorithms, such as RSA or AES, rely on computational difficulty for their security. However, quantum computers could break these algorithms by using quantum algorithms like Shor’s algorithm, making traditional encryption methods obsolete. Quantum encryption provides a higher level of resistance against such breaches by using quantum key distribution (QKD) to ensure secure key exchanges.2. Real-Time Security in Proxy IP Networks: One of the major advantages quantum encryption brings to proxy IP security is the ability to establish real-time, unbreakable secure connections. The ability to detect tampering during the key exchange process enables more immediate response to potential attacks, ensuring that the encrypted connection remains intact.3. Future-Proofing Proxy IP Services: With the advent of quantum computing, proxy IP services need to evolve to meet these emerging threats. Quantum encryption could provide a long-term solution to safeguard proxy IP networks, offering encryption methods that are more resilient to quantum decryption techniques. By adopting quantum-resistant algorithms, proxy IP services could effectively mitigate the risks posed by quantum computers, ensuring continued user privacy in the future.Challenges in Integrating Quantum Encryption with Proxy IP SecurityDespite the advantages, several challenges exist when integrating quantum encryption into the existing infrastructure of proxy IP services.1. Cost and Complexity of Quantum Encryption Implementation: One of the primary barriers to quantum encryption is the cost and technical complexity of implementing quantum cryptography systems. Unlike traditional encryption, quantum encryption requires advanced hardware to generate and distribute quantum keys. The current infrastructure of proxy IP providers may not be equipped to handle this level of sophistication, leading to higher implementation costs and the need for significant technological upgrades.2. Limited Availability of Quantum Infrastructure: Quantum encryption relies heavily on the availability of quantum communication infrastructure, which is not yet widely accessible. Quantum key distribution, for instance, requires specialized equipment and infrastructure to operate effectively. Proxy IP services may find it challenging to incorporate quantum encryption into their systems if such infrastructure is not readily available or affordable.3. Interoperability Issues with Existing Cryptographic Protocols: Another challenge is the potential incompatibility between quantum encryption systems and the traditional cryptographic protocols already in use. Many existing proxy IP services use conventional encryption methods that may not be compatible with quantum encryption. This could result in operational inefficiencies and the need for significant upgrades to the security architecture of proxy IP networks.4. Quantum-Specific Security Concerns: While quantum encryption promises to be more secure than classical methods, it is not entirely immune to risks. For instance, quantum systems could be susceptible to new forms of attack that exploit the peculiarities of quantum mechanics. Additionally, the generation and distribution of quantum keys require a high level of precision, and any errors in the process could compromise the integrity of the entire encryption system.The Future of Proxy IP Security in the Quantum EraLooking ahead, the integration of quantum encryption into proxy IP services offers great potential for strengthening privacy and security. As quantum computing continues to evolve, it is likely that hybrid systems, which combine both classical and quantum encryption methods, will emerge to address the challenges and limitations of each approach.1. Development of Quantum-Resistant Protocols: Researchers are already working on developing quantum-resistant cryptographic protocols that could be integrated with existing proxy IP services. These protocols would enable proxy IP providers to safeguard their users from both classical and quantum-based threats, ensuring comprehensive protection in the post-quantum era.2. Collaborative Efforts between Quantum and Cybersecurity Experts: The successful integration of quantum encryption into proxy IP security will require collaboration between quantum physicists, cybersecurity experts, and industry leaders. By working together, they can create robust encryption systems that are not only quantum-safe but also scalable and cost-effective for large-scale use.3. Long-Term Sustainability of Proxy IP Services: As the world moves toward a quantum future, it is crucial for proxy IP providers to stay ahead of emerging trends and technological advancements. Adopting quantum encryption early on could offer a competitive advantage in the cybersecurity market, positioning these services as secure, future-proof solutions for users concerned with privacy.Quantum encryption technology presents both significant opportunities and challenges for the future of proxy IP security. While it offers enhanced protection against traditional cyber threats and provides a path forward for securing communications in the quantum age, the implementation of this technology in proxy IP networks comes with considerable technical, financial, and infrastructure-related hurdles. However, with continued research, development, and collaboration, quantum encryption could ultimately transform proxy IP security, offering more robust and resilient protection for users in an increasingly digital world.

Deploying a scalable HTTP proxy cluster using Docker

Deploying a scalable HTTP proxy cluster using Docker allows businesses and developers to efficiently manage large amounts of web traffic while ensuring optimal performance and scalability. Docker provides a containerization solution that simplifies the management of the proxy servers in a clustered environment. This approach allows for better resource utilization, easier maintenance, and improved fault tolerance. In this article, we will explore how Docker can be leveraged to deploy a scalable HTTP proxy cluster, its advantages, and the best practices for setting it up and maintaining it effectively. Introduction to HTTP Proxy and DockerAn HTTP proxy is an intermediary server that sits between clients and the web, forwarding client requests to the web servers and returning the responses. The proxy server can provide various benefits such as load balancing, enhanced security, anonymity, and improved performance. It is particularly useful when managing high-volume traffic or when geographical distribution is required.Docker, on the other hand, is a containerization platform that enables applications to run in isolated environments called containers. These containers are lightweight and portable, ensuring that applications can run consistently across different environments. Docker's flexibility allows it to be an excellent choice for deploying scalable HTTP proxy clusters, making it easier to scale, manage, and maintain these clusters.Benefits of Using Docker for HTTP Proxy Clusters1. ScalabilityOne of the key benefits of deploying an HTTP proxy cluster using Docker is scalability. As web traffic increases, businesses need to ensure that their proxy servers can handle the load. Docker makes it easy to scale the proxy cluster horizontally by adding new containers to meet growing demand. Docker Swarm or Kubernetes can manage the orchestration of these containers, ensuring that they are distributed across multiple machines and balanced properly.2. Efficient Resource ManagementDocker containers are lightweight compared to traditional virtual machines, allowing for more efficient use of system resources. This efficiency reduces hardware costs and ensures that the proxy servers run optimally. Docker also offers fine-grained control over resource allocation, such as CPU, memory, and disk space, which is crucial in a high-traffic environment.3. Simplified MaintenanceWith Docker, each proxy server runs in its own isolated container. This isolation simplifies the process of updating and maintaining the system. When an update is required, the affected container can be replaced without impacting the rest of the cluster. Additionally, Docker's built-in versioning system ensures that the correct version of the proxy server is always running.4. Fault Tolerance and High AvailabilityBy deploying multiple proxy servers across different containers, Docker ensures that the system remains highly available even if one or more containers fail. Docker's built-in health checks and monitoring tools can automatically detect failures and restart the affected containers, maintaining the stability of the proxy cluster.5. SecurityDocker provides several security features that enhance the security of the HTTP proxy cluster. Each container runs in an isolated environment, reducing the risk of a security breach affecting the entire system. Additionally, Docker allows for fine-grained control over network configurations, ensuring that sensitive data is protected during transit.Designing a Scalable HTTP Proxy Cluster with Docker1. Choosing the Right Proxy Server SoftwareThe first step in deploying an HTTP proxy cluster is selecting the right proxy server software. There are several options available, including open-source solutions like Squid, HAProxy, and Nginx. Each of these solutions has its own strengths and weaknesses, so it’s important to choose the one that best suits your needs in terms of performance, security, and flexibility.2. Setting Up Docker ContainersOnce the proxy server software is selected, the next step is to set up Docker containers for each instance of the proxy server. Docker provides a simple way to define and configure containers using Dockerfiles. A Dockerfile contains instructions on how to build the container, including installing the proxy server software and configuring it to work with the desired settings.3. Orchestrating the Cluster with Docker Swarm or KubernetesIn order to scale the HTTP proxy cluster, you will need to use an orchestration tool such as Docker Swarm or Kubernetes. These tools manage the deployment, scaling, and monitoring of Docker containers across a cluster of machines. Docker Swarm is easier to set up and is ideal for smaller clusters, while Kubernetes is more powerful and suited for large-scale deployments.4. Configuring Load BalancingTo ensure that traffic is distributed evenly across the proxy servers, load balancing is an essential component of the cluster. Docker makes it easy to set up load balancing with tools like HAProxy or Nginx, which can distribute incoming HTTP requests among multiple proxy server containers based on various algorithms such as round-robin, least connections, or IP hash.5. Monitoring and LoggingEffective monitoring and logging are essential for maintaining the health of the HTTP proxy cluster. Docker provides several monitoring tools, such as Docker stats and third-party tools like Prometheus and Grafana, which allow you to track the performance and resource usage of the containers. Additionally, setting up centralized logging with tools like ELK Stack (Elasticsearch, Logstash, and Kibana) can help you identify and troubleshoot issues in real-time.Best Practices for Maintaining the HTTP Proxy Cluster1. Automate Deployment and ScalingAutomating the deployment and scaling of Docker containers ensures that the proxy cluster can respond to changes in traffic volume without manual intervention. Docker Compose can be used to define multi-container applications, while tools like Jenkins or GitLab CI can automate the process of deploying new containers or updating existing ones.2. Regularly Update and Patch ContainersKeeping the proxy server containers up to date is crucial for security and performance. Regularly checking for updates and patches for the proxy server software and other dependencies will ensure that your system remains secure and efficient.3. Implement Network SegmentationNetwork segmentation is a security best practice that involves dividing the network into smaller subnets. By segmenting the network, you can isolate sensitive components, such as the database or internal services, from the public-facing proxy servers. Docker provides tools to define network policies and ensure secure communication between containers.4. Perform Regular BackupsWhile Docker provides a robust system for managing containers, it is still important to perform regular backups of your configuration files and container data. Backups ensure that you can quickly restore your proxy cluster in case of a failure or disaster.Deploying a scalable HTTP proxy cluster using Docker provides several advantages, including improved scalability, resource management, fault tolerance, and security. By leveraging Docker's containerization capabilities and orchestration tools like Docker Swarm or Kubernetes, businesses can efficiently handle high volumes of web traffic while maintaining optimal performance. Following best practices such as automating deployment, regular updates, and network segmentation ensures the continued success and security of the proxy cluster, making it an invaluable tool for modern web infrastructure.

How can I check if the SOCKS5 proxy supports the required security protocols and authentication?

When using a socks5 proxy, security and authentication are crucial elements to ensure that data transmission is secure and meets your privacy requirements. A SOCKS5 proxy differs from other types of proxies by providing greater flexibility, such as supporting a variety of authentication methods and allowing connections to a broader range of protocols. However, ensuring that the proxy supports the required security protocols and proper authentication mechanisms is essential before relying on it for sensitive activities. This article outlines key steps and techniques to help users check whether a SOCKS5 proxy is compatible with their security and authentication needs. Understanding the Basics of SOCKS5 ProxyBefore diving into how to check security protocols and authentication methods, it's essential to understand what socks5 proxies are and how they work. A SOCKS5 proxy functions as an intermediary between a user's device and the internet, routing traffic to destinations through its server. This type of proxy supports various types of internet traffic, such as HTTP, FTP, and TCP/UDP connections, which makes it highly versatile.One of the key features of SOCKS5 is its ability to work with a wide array of protocols. It can handle any kind of protocol that is not tied to a specific service, such as web browsing or file transfers. SOCKS5 also supports authentication methods, allowing users to secure their connection with a username and password. However, not all SOCKS5 proxies are created equal, and it’s vital to verify that the proxy you're using meets the specific security and authentication standards required for your activities.Step 1: Verify SOCKS5 Proxy Supports SSL/TLS EncryptionEncryption is a fundamental security measure when using any kind of proxy server. SOCKS5 itself does not provide encryption, meaning that if the data sent through the proxy is not encrypted, it can be intercepted and compromised. To ensure secure communication, it’s essential to confirm that the SOCKS5 proxy works with SSL/TLS (Secure Sockets Layer/Transport Layer Security).SSL/TLS encryption secures the connection between the client and the server by encrypting the data before it is transmitted. This prevents eavesdropping and tampering, which is particularly crucial for sensitive information like login credentials or financial data.To check if your SOCKS5 proxy supports SSL/TLS encryption:1. Check Documentation: Look for any mention of SSL/TLS support in the documentation or settings of your SOCKS5 proxy.2. Run Tests: Use online tools or testing software to verify the encryption support during connection attempts.3. Contact Support: If documentation isn’t clear, contact the service provider or consult community forums for feedback from other users who may have tested the security features.Step 2: Assess Authentication Methods Supported by SOCKS5 ProxyAuthentication methods are critical in ensuring that unauthorized users do not gain access to the proxy. SOCKS5 supports several types of authentication, including "No Authentication," "Username and Password Authentication," and sometimes more advanced mechanisms like "GSSAPI Authentication."Here’s how to check which authentication methods are supported by your SOCKS5 proxy:1. Testing Authentication Types: Most SOCKS5 proxies support basic username/password authentication. You can test this by configuring the proxy with valid credentials and seeing if access is granted. Some proxies will require you to provide credentials explicitly, so ensure you have valid credentials for testing. 2. Protocol Testing Tools: There are various tools available that simulate the SOCKS5 connection and help identify which authentication mechanisms are supported. You can use tools such as `curl`, `proxychains`, or even specific SOCKS5 testing tools to simulate a connection and observe the response to authentication attempts.3. Request a List of Supported Authentication Methods: If you're unsure, check the proxy settings or contact support to inquire about the supported authentication methods. Step 3: Test the SOCKS5 Proxy for DNS LeaksA DNS leak occurs when your DNS requests (the lookup process of translating domain names into IP addresses) are sent outside the proxy tunnel. This can expose your actual IP address and potentially compromise your anonymity and privacy. Therefore, testing for DNS leaks is a critical part of determining whether the SOCKS5 proxy supports sufficient security protocols.To check for DNS leaks:1. Run DNS Leak Test: Use online DNS leak testing tools that will show whether your DNS requests are leaking outside the secure tunnel.2. Manually Inspect the Configuration: Check if the proxy configuration allows DNS requests to be routed through the SOCKS5 tunnel. Ideally, your DNS queries should not be sent to external servers that bypass the proxy.Step 4: Ensure SOCKS5 Proxy Handles IP Authentication and AnonymityAnother aspect of proxy security is ensuring that your real IP address is not exposed during communication. SOCKS5 proxies are generally designed to handle IP masking and anonymity, but you should confirm that the proxy ensures proper IP authentication.1. Check for WebRTC Leaks: WebRTC is a technology that can bypass proxies and reveal your real IP address. You can test for WebRTC leaks by visiting websites that offer WebRTC leak tests and checking if any information about your actual IP address is revealed. 2. Conduct IP Leak Tests: Use online services to check if the IP address shown is that of the proxy server or your actual IP address. If your real IP address is exposed, the proxy is not functioning as intended.Step 5: Review Proxy Logs and Traffic LogsSome SOCKS5 proxies may maintain logs of your activities, including connection times, IP addresses, and data transfers. To ensure privacy and security, it’s essential to review the logging policies of the SOCKS5 proxy.1. Check Logging Policies: Ideally, a SOCKS5 proxy should have a strict no-logging policy, meaning it doesn’t store any of your browsing or connection data. 2. Review Proxy Server Logs: If you have access to the proxy’s logs (usually available for private proxies), review them to ensure no sensitive information, such as authentication details or connection data, is being stored.Step 6: Evaluate Compatibility with Secure ApplicationsCertain applications or services require specific security protocols when using proxies. For example, some online banking platforms or corporate VPN services may require additional security checks or support for particular encryption algorithms.To ensure that your SOCKS5 proxy is compatible with these types of applications:1. Check with the Service Provider: Confirm with the platform or service you are using whether they recommend specific SOCKS5 proxy settings or security protocols. 2. Conduct Real-World Testing: Perform live tests using your SOCKS5 proxy with the applications that require secure communication, ensuring there are no compatibility issues.ConclusionWhen selecting a SOCKS5 proxy, security and authentication are of the utmost importance. By verifying encryption support, authentication methods, and the ability to protect against leaks, users can ensure that their data remains secure and their online activities are kept private. Running the proper tests and reviewing the proxy’s documentation or support resources can go a long way in confirming that the SOCKS5 proxy meets your specific security requirements. Always be proactive about checking these features before engaging in any sensitive activities to ensure your online safety.

Can I improve my game latency performance by using the PYPROXY SOCKS5 proxy?

With the ever-growing demand for faster and more responsive gaming experiences, players constantly seek ways to minimize latency, reduce lag, and enhance overall performance. One potential method to achieve these goals is through the use of proxies, specifically socks5 proxies. While proxies are widely known for their role in increasing privacy and security, their impact on gaming performance is often debated. This article explores whether using a PYPROXY socks5 proxy can help reduce game latency, offering a deep dive into its workings and potential advantages for gamers looking to optimize their experience. Understanding SOCKS5 Proxy and Its Impact on Network TrafficBefore we delve into how a SOCKS5 proxy can affect game latency, it's important to first understand what a SOCKS5 proxy is and how it works. A SOCKS5 proxy is a type of internet protocol that allows users to route their internet traffic through a third-party server, providing an intermediary between the user and the destination server. Unlike traditional proxies, SOCKS5 supports a wide range of internet protocols, including TCP, UDP, and ICMP, which makes it a versatile option for various online activities.SOCKS5 proxies essentially work by forwarding data packets from the client (gamer) to the server through the proxy server, masking the original IP address. This means that the destination server only sees the proxy’s IP address, not the gamer’s, adding a layer of privacy and security. However, the key consideration here is whether this added route increases or decreases latency during gaming sessions.How Latency Works in Online GamingLatency, in the context of online gaming, refers to the delay between a player's action and the server’s response. It is typically measured in milliseconds (ms), and lower latency means a more responsive and enjoyable gaming experience. High latency can lead to issues such as lag, rubberbanding, and delayed reactions, all of which are detrimental to a seamless gameplay experience.When gaming online, the goal is to ensure that data packets travel as quickly as possible from the player’s device to the game server and back. The fewer hops the data has to make, the better the overall latency. Therefore, any method that introduces additional routing steps could potentially increase the time it takes for data to travel between the player and the server.Potential Effects of Using a SOCKS5 Proxy on Game LatencyUsing a SOCKS5 proxy introduces an extra layer in the communication process, which might have both positive and negative impacts on gaming latency. To evaluate its effectiveness, we need to consider several key factors:1. Routing Path Optimization One of the main arguments in favor of using proxies is that they can help optimize routing paths. In some cases, a proxy server located closer to the game server than the player's original connection could reduce the distance data must travel, potentially lowering latency. This is especially true when a user’s ISP (Internet Service Provider) takes a suboptimal route for data transmission. By routing traffic through a more efficient path via a SOCKS5 proxy, the data might reach the server more quickly.2. Traffic Load and Congestion On the flip side, if the proxy server becomes a bottleneck due to high traffic or subpar performance, it can actually increase latency. A congested proxy server might delay the data transfer, leading to higher latency and a less responsive gaming experience. This is particularly relevant in online multiplayer games, where split-second reactions are critical.3. ISP Throttling or Geo-Restrictions Some players face latency issues due to ISP throttling or regional restrictions placed by their internet service providers. SOCKS5 proxies, particularly those that allow users to connect to servers in different locations, might help bypass such throttling or geo-blocking. By connecting to a server with better routing or a less congested network, players might experience improved latency or reduced packet loss.4. Server Location and Distance The physical location of the socks5 proxy server plays a crucial role in its impact on latency. If the proxy server is geographically far from the game server, the extra hop could increase latency instead of improving it. On the other hand, connecting to a proxy server that is closer to the game server can reduce the total distance traveled by data packets, lowering latency.5. Encryption and Security Overhead Some SOCKS5 proxies may add a level of encryption to the data being transferred, which can increase the time it takes to process and route the packets. While encryption improves security, it may add some overhead, especially for real-time applications like gaming. If the proxy enforces heavy encryption, it could negatively impact the overall gaming experience by increasing latency.Pros and Cons of Using SOCKS5 Proxy for GamingTo better understand whether a SOCKS5 proxy is beneficial for game latency, let’s look at some of the pros and cons of using this technology in the context of gaming:Pros:1. Potential to Bypass Throttling and Geo-Restrictions SOCKS5 proxies can allow players to bypass ISP throttling or regional restrictions, which may be contributing to latency issues.2. Improved Privacy and Security By masking the player’s IP address, a SOCKS5 proxy can offer increased privacy and security, which might be beneficial for players concerned about online safety.3. Better Routing in Some Cases If the proxy server is well-optimized and geographically close to the game server, it could reduce latency by offering a better route than the player’s default ISP.Cons:1. Increased Latency in Some Cases The extra hop introduced by the proxy server can result in higher latency, especially if the proxy server is congested or far from the game server.2. Potential Overhead from Encryption Some SOCKS5 proxies add encryption to secure data, which could cause a slight delay in data processing and increase latency.3. Dependence on Proxy Server Quality Not all SOCKS5 proxies are created equal. Poorly maintained or low-quality proxy servers can degrade performance and increase lag.Conclusion: Is SOCKS5 Proxy Worth It for Reducing Game Latency?In conclusion, the impact of using a SOCKS5 proxy on game latency is highly dependent on a variety of factors, including the quality of the proxy server, its geographic location, the routing path chosen, and whether encryption is applied. For certain players, especially those experiencing throttling or regional restrictions, a SOCKS5 proxy may provide a significant improvement in latency by offering a more optimal routing path.However, for others, the additional hop introduced by the proxy server might cause an increase in latency, particularly if the proxy server is congested or geographically distant from the game server. Players looking to use a SOCKS5 proxy should weigh the pros and cons carefully, considering their specific needs and testing the proxy’s performance to see if it provides tangible improvements in their gaming experience.Ultimately, while a SOCKS5 proxy may offer some benefits, it is not a guaranteed solution for reducing game latency across the board. For many gamers, a stable and fast direct connection to the game server will continue to be the best way to ensure low latency and smooth gameplay.

How to avoid the low price trap when buying a SOCKS5 proxy?

When considering the purchase of socks5 proxies, many individuals and businesses are attracted by the promise of low prices. However, it’s crucial to understand that not all proxies are created equal, and a cheap price might indicate poor quality, limited functionality, or even potential risks to your privacy and security. This article aims to guide you through the process of identifying and avoiding low-price traps when purchasing SOCKS5 proxies. It will provide you with the knowledge needed to ensure you are investing in a reliable, high-quality service that meets your needs without compromising on security or performance. Understanding SOCKS5 Proxies and Their ImportanceBefore diving into the specifics of avoiding low-price traps, it's important to have a basic understanding of what SOCKS5 proxies are and why they are commonly used. SOCKS5 is a type of internet protocol that routes your internet traffic through a third-party server, providing anonymity and access to geo-blocked content. SOCKS5 proxies are preferred by users who need a higher level of security and flexibility, especially for activities like web scraping, bypassing geo-restrictions, and maintaining privacy.However, the key to ensuring that you are getting value for your money lies in understanding what makes a socks5 proxy service high-quality. These services should offer robust security features, fast connection speeds, and a reliable infrastructure. Low-cost proxies may tempt you, but they often come with trade-offs in performance and reliability.Why Do Cheap SOCKS5 Proxies Exist?To understand why low-price SOCKS5 proxies are so prevalent, it’s essential to look at the underlying business models. In many cases, cheap proxies are the result of services that rely on low-quality infrastructure or cut corners in order to maintain profitability. Some of the reasons behind low-priced SOCKS5 proxies include:1. Low-quality servers: Some providers use outdated, slow, or oversubscribed servers, which can lead to poor performance and unreliable service.2. Overselling resources: In an effort to maximize profits, some providers oversell their server resources, which can cause slow speeds and unreliable connections.3. Lack of customer support: Many low-cost proxy providers don’t invest in customer service, which can leave you stranded if you experience technical issues.4. Security risks: Low-priced services may not have the necessary security protocols in place to protect your data and online activity.These factors highlight the potential risks of opting for cheap SOCKS5 proxies, and why it’s essential to approach these offers with caution.Key Risks Associated with Low-Price SOCKS5 Proxies1. Privacy and Security ConcernsCheap SOCKS5 proxies often fail to offer robust encryption or proper security measures, making your data vulnerable to hacking or interception. Some providers may even log your activity, which defeats the purpose of using a proxy for anonymity. A reputable proxy provider should prioritize customer privacy and offer features like secure encryption to protect your sensitive information.2. Unreliable PerformancePerformance is a major consideration when purchasing SOCKS5 proxies. Low-priced services may be oversold, which means your connection could become unstable or slow due to bandwidth limitations. This is especially problematic if you rely on proxies for tasks like streaming, scraping, or gaming, where speed and reliability are crucial.3. Lack of Customer SupportCustomer support is often overlooked by low-cost proxy providers. In case you encounter any issues or need assistance setting up or troubleshooting your proxy service, lack of support can be frustrating and time-consuming. A provider with 24/7 customer support ensures that you can resolve issues quickly and minimize downtime.4. Potential Scams and Fraudulent ServicesThere’s always a risk when purchasing proxies from unverified or suspicious sources. Some low-cost proxy services may be part of a scam, offering cheap proxies only to disappear once they have your payment information. It’s essential to vet the provider thoroughly to avoid falling victim to such schemes.How to Safely Navigate the SOCKS5 Proxy MarketGiven the risks, here are several strategies to help you make an informed decision when purchasing SOCKS5 proxies.1. Assess the Provider’s ReputationOne of the most effective ways to avoid falling into the low-price trap is by researching the reputation of the provider. Look for reviews and testimonials from real users to gauge the reliability and quality of the service. Pay attention to factors like:- Connection speed- Customer service responsiveness- Overall satisfaction with the serviceReliable proxy providers often have a strong online presence and positive feedback across multiple platforms. Additionally, you can check forums or communities where proxy users discuss their experiences.2. Test the Service Before CommittingMany reputable SOCKS5 proxy providers offer free trials or money-back guarantees. This allows you to test the service’s performance and reliability before committing to a long-term plan. Take advantage of these offers to evaluate key factors like connection speed, security, and ease of use.During your trial period, pay attention to:- Connection speed and latency- Uptime and reliability- The functionality of the proxy for your intended use3. Look for Transparent PricingA reputable SOCKS5 proxy provider will be transparent about its pricing. Avoid services that have hidden fees or unclear pricing structures. Compare the costs of different providers, but also consider the value you are getting in return. Cheaper services often cut corners on infrastructure and security, which can end up costing you more in the long run if issues arise.4. Evaluate the Quality of Customer SupportThe quality of customer support should be a top priority when selecting a SOCKS5 proxy provider. Reach out to the provider before purchasing to assess their responsiveness and willingness to help. You can also inquire about their support channels (e.g., email, live chat, phone) and ensure they offer 24/7 assistance in case you encounter any issues.5. Review the Security and Privacy PolicyA trustworthy proxy provider will have clear, comprehensive security and privacy policies in place. Ensure that the provider doesn’t log your browsing activity or share your personal data with third parties. Look for services that offer strong encryption and other security features like IP whitelisting, multi-factor authentication, and SOCKS5-specific protections.6. Avoid Deals That Seem Too Good to Be TrueIf a deal seems too good to be true, it likely is. Be wary of providers offering significantly lower prices than their competitors. These deals may indicate hidden issues such as poor performance, limited support, or security vulnerabilities. When in doubt, it’s better to invest a bit more in a reputable service to avoid costly problems later on.ConclusionWhile low-price SOCKS5 proxies can seem tempting, they often come with hidden risks that can negatively impact your security, performance, and overall experience. By understanding the potential downsides and taking the necessary precautions, you can avoid falling into the low-price trap and ensure that you are investing in a reliable and secure proxy service. Always prioritize reputation, transparency, customer support, and security over price alone, and conduct thorough research before making your final purchase decision. Ultimately, a higher price often correlates with better quality, reliability, and peace of mind.
